WebThe ModelMatrixModel () function in the package in default return a class containing a sparse matrix with all levels of dummy variables which is suitable for input in cv.glmnet () in glmnet package. Importantly, returned class also stores transforming parameters such as the factor level information, which can then be applied to new data. WebCreating interactions with recipes requires the use of a model formula, such as. In R model formulae, using a * between two variables would expand to a*b = a + b + a:b so that the main effects are included. In step_interact , you can do use *, but only the interactions are recorded as columns that needs to be created. WebA common default for regressions would be to encode an N-level categorical variable with N-1 binary variables. This is often called creating dummy variables. In this scenario, one level will be implicitly represented by all zeroes in the N-1 variables. This may not make sense for lasso because the shrinkage will move towards this implicit level ... WebThe first two arguments that glmnet () is expecting are a matrix of the predictors ( x, in your case) and a vector of the response ( g4, in your case). For the x matrix, it is expecting that you have already dummied out any categorical variables. The L1 regularization is known as the lasso and produces sparsity. glinternet uses a group lasso for the variables and variable interactions, which introduces the following strong hierarchy: An interaction between \(X_i\) and \(X_j\) can only be picked by the model if both \(X_i\) and \(X_j\) are also picked.
